Job Description Responsibilities:
Constant monitoring of the Facilities inbox and Vixxo portal to vet, qualify and authorize work of the Facilities Maintenance Vendors.
Assists with all Support Center needs under direction of the Executive Assistant.
Enter all preventative maintenance contracts, as required by lease, and other vendor contacts in CoStar.
Monitor response times and communicate with vendors to ensure quality work performed within expected time frames.
Receive and distribute all mail received at the Support Center, including retrieval of mail from the US Government Client Post Office Box. This also includes scanning to send to remote staff or others.
Responsible for all shipping and receiving, including UPS, FedEx and any other shipments received or needing to be shipped. This includes receiving and reshipping hearing aids and supplies inadvertently shipped to the Support Center.
Provides UPS labels and supplies, when requested. Also assist IT with the shipping of equipment for new or terminated staff.
Maintains all Support Center supplies, including break rooms, bathrooms, meeting rooms, copy room and training room.
Provides assistance to subtenant, when needed.
Communicate with Landlords and Property Managers regarding any issues for which they are responsible, roof access when needed or any required landlord approvals. Maintain Property Manager spreadsheet in Teams.
Enter PO requests within B.C. System to generate PO’s.
Qualifications:
High school diploma or equivalent
Must have excellent follow-up skills
Must have strong organizational skills
Must possess strong attention to detail
Excellent verbal and written communication
Administrative experience preferred
Property management background preferred
